Dog Licensing
In Kalamazoo County, dog licensing is mandatory for all dogs. Michigan State Law requires all dogs to be rabies vaccinated and licensed at four months of age.
Dogs must be licensed within 30 days of obtaining ownership or within 30 days of the dog turning 4 months of age. If you're a new resident, you'll need to get your dog licensed as soon as possible.

You can purchase a license for your dog at various locations, including Animal Services, area veterinary offices, township/city offices, and the Kalamazoo County Treasurer's Office. Licenses are also available online through the Kalamazoo County website.

Dog Licensing Season Opens
Dog licensing season is officially underway in Kalamazoo County, and residents are reminded to renew their licenses promptly. Online renewals are available at ase.kalcounty.com, making it easy to update your dog's information and pay the license fee.
You can renew your dog's license online, but if you're a first-time applicant, you'll need to call 269-383-8775 to get an online account and pin number. Don't worry, it's a quick and easy process.
New owners or those with dogs reaching 4 months of age must license their pets within 30 days, as Michigan State Law requires all dogs to be rabies vaccinated and licensed by this age. This is a crucial step in ensuring your dog's health and safety.

What do you need to get a dog license in Michigan?
To get a dog license in Michigan, you'll need a current rabies vaccination certificate and proof of spaying/neutering, which can be submitted with a Veterinarian's Certificate of Sterilization. This will cost $7.50 and requires a signed certificate from a veterinarian.
How many dogs can you have in Kalamazoo?
To own dogs in Kalamazoo, you can have up to 3 dogs at a single location without needing a kennel license. However, owning more than 3 dogs may require a kennel license, so check local regulations for details.
